The Village

The Village explores the residents of a Manhattan apartment building who find that, despite a difference in age, race, culture and lifestyle, find that the more their lives intertwine, the more complex and compelling their connections become, thus proving life's challenges are better faced alongside family, even if it's the one you make wherever you find it. All under one roof we will meet a recovering war vet, a pregnant teenage girl and her single mom, a cop with an unexpected love interest, a woman hiding a terrifying secret from her husband and a millennial lawyer who might find his grandfather is the best and worst roommate he ever could have hoped for.
